What is it? Well, for those of you old enough to remember Firefox Send, a secure filesharing platform - well, this is it, reimagined for 2024.
Imagine the last time you moved into a new apartment or purchased a home and had to share financial information like your credit report over the web. In situations like this, you may want to offer the recipient one-time or limited access to those files. With All The Files, you can feel safe that your personal information does not live somewhere in the cloud indefinitely.

Gif by canekzapatap on Giphy
AllThe Files uses end-to-end encryption to keep your data secure from the moment you share to the moment your file is opened. It also offers security controls that you can set. You can choose when your file link expires, the number of downloads, and whether to add an optional password for an extra layer of security.
The source code is available for all to see on Github, and we are proud to be listed as one of only a handful of proven instances of the software. We also happen to be rocking %100 uptime!
